Representative Spencer Roach Joins the Law Office of Jeffrey M. Janeiro, P.L.

NAPLES, FLORIDA  – The Law Office of Jeffrey M. Janeiro, P.L., is pleased to announce that State Representative Spencer Roach has joined the firm.

Representative Roach is a retired Judge Advocate with 20 years of service in the United States Coast Guard. He served as a search and rescue coxswain and counter-narcotics officer prior to being selected for the prestigious Judge Advocate General (JAG) Program. He attended the University of Miami School of Law and is licensed to practice law in both Florida and Texas.

Representative Roach was recently elected without opposition to a third term in the Florida House of Representatives, where he currently serves on the full Judiciary Committee, the Children, Families and Seniors Subcommittee, and as a Vice Chair of the Criminal Justice Subcommittee.

Spencer was inducted into the Soaring Eagles Distinguished Alumni Association and was profiled in the National Jurist magazine in 2009. He is a certified ESL teacher and has been an active volunteer with Big Brothers/Big Sisters, the Guardian ad Litem program in the 20th Judicial Circuit and is also a licensed foster parent. He is an avid scuba diver and traveler, with a focus on Central and South America.
